Collateral grading systems in retrograde percutaneous coronary intervention of chronic total occlusions

Insights

The Japanese Channel (J-Channel) score shows promise for guiding retrograde percutaneous coronary intervention (PCI) in chronic total occlusions (CTOs). However, its ability to predict overall technical success in CTO PCI is limited, similar to other collateral grading systems.

Background:

  • The Japanese Channel (J-Channel) score was developed to assist in retrograde percutaneous coronary intervention (PCI) for chronic total coronary occlusions (CTOs).
  • The predictive capabilities of the J-Channel score have not been compared against established collateral grading systems like the Rentrop classification and Werner grade.

Purpose of the Study:

  • To evaluate the predictive value of the J-Channel score, Rentrop classification, and Werner grade.
  • To assess their effectiveness in predicting successful collateral channel (CC) guidewire crossing and technical success in CTO PCI.

Main Methods:

  • A prospective study involving 600 patients undergoing CTO PCI.
  • Collateral grading systems were assessed using dual catheter injection.
  • Successful CC guidewire crossing and technical CTO PCI success were defined based on specific criteria.

Main Results:

  • The J-Channel score demonstrated predictive value for CC guidewire crossing, comparable to Rentrop classification and superior to Werner grade (AUC 0.743).
  • Technical CTO PCI success was achieved in 90% of patients.
  • Rentrop classification showed slightly better discrimination for technical success (0.676) than J-Channel (0.664) and Werner grade (0.589).

Conclusions:

  • The J-Channel score may assist in selecting collateral channels for retrograde CTO PCI.
  • All evaluated grading systems (J-Channel, Rentrop, Werner) have limited predictive value for the technical success of CTO PCI.
